Lathe PM4000 with 400 volt motor, 1.5 kW and measuring system

Intended use

The PM4000 is a centre lathe and feed spindle lathe for use in the high-end hobby and semi-professional sector. Thanks to its versatile range of applications, this lathe is used in model making, in one-off and small series production, in prototype construction and in repair and training workshops. The lathe is designed for machining steel, cast iron, all non-ferrous metals, aluminium, brass, etc., but can also be used for machining plastics or similar materials that are not hazardous to health or generate dust.

Description of the

The PM4000 lathe is supplied with a matching base frame. The metal lathe is driven by a powerful 400 volt three-phase motor with an output power of 1,500 watts. Power is reliably transmitted via a two-stage double pulley, which allows the user to switch between the high and low speed ranges (by changing the drive belts). The working spindle gearbox, which runs in an oil bath, has nine different spindle speeds, which can be selected via two control levers. This means that a total of 18 speeds from 65 to 1,810 rpm can be set. The automatic longitudinal and face feed is carried out via the feed spindle equipped with a slip clutch. During thread cutting, the feed is realised via the lead screw and the lock nut.
Switching on the lead or pull spindle and setting the different feed speeds for turning or the desired pitch for thread cutting is done via four control levers on the separate feed gearbox. The direction of rotation of the lead or pull spindle can be changed independently of the direction of rotation of the lathe chuck by moving a shift lever. This means that this hobby lathe can also be used to produce left-hand threads. The lead screw is completely covered to prevent accidental intervention, and this protection also prevents falling metal chips from sticking. This prevents unnecessary wear and possible damage to the lock nut. The prism bed is induction hardened and ground. The machine bed also has a removable bed bridge.
This enables the machining of turned parts with a diameter of up to approx. 450 mm. The PM4000 is also equipped with a foot brake. This allows the lathe to be stopped with pinpoint accuracy, for example when thread cutting. All guides can be adjusted backlash-free using wedge strips. The main spindle runs in precision tapered roller bearings, which can be readjusted if necessary. The top slide can be rotated and is therefore suitable for taper turning. The tailstock can also be moved transversely for taper turning. A professional control lever is used to switch the lathe on and off (clockwise or anti-clockwise rotation). The torque button, the operating light and the emergency stop button are located on the control panel on the headstock. Other special features include a centre distance of 900 mm and a spindle bore of 38 mm.

Great value for money

Before I bought the lathe, I got quick and qualified answers to my questions. The delivery was quick. This lathe is the real deal! I have had a similar size Vario lathe of another brand that was terrible, this geared lathe is so much better, stronger, heavier, it is great value for money. Is it perfect - no, you don´t get perfect in this price range, with these imported machines you should always expect to put in some hours to get it how you want it, but this lathe is worth it, you will have a great lathe for many years. I was hesitant about buying an imported geared lathe, even that I overall prefer a geared lathe, I have seen some Chinese lathes that made terrible noise from the gears, this lathe have hardened and ground gears, and they run relative quiet. Not as quiet as a really expensive lathe, but this lathe have a very acceptable noise level compared to other Chinese machines I have seen, I am very satisfied. One weird thing, the overhang on the tailstock points the wrong way, it should have overhang towards the chuck and not away from the chuck.

The new lathe is now installed and the power connected. I have to power the lathe with a VFD. This is relatively easy to do if you are a competent electrician with a good working knowledge of 3 phase motors and machine control wiring. First impressions are that this is a very good machine for the home workshop. Many of the points in older reviews have been address making this a very nice machine. The only item that has been a small problem is the tail stock tool ejector is too long for the drill chuck/arbor they sell. The tang on the MK3 taper has to be removed and the taper shortened to get the maximum drilling depth. This is not a problem as the tang on a Morse taper is there for removing the arbor with a tapered drift in a pillar drill. I will be using Paulimot again.
